Output f38353a5c3b1e84dfc3c8fd1a2fd1c9837049cb6bd5695973f73b316957079eb:2

value
652666927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ac95b6d625ae7713ec4026e9382806a30b06bac OP_EQUAL
address
MK6PtNa2zXLa43PpgkEBoe9P4VhvpJT6cZ
transaction
f38353a5c3b1e84dfc3c8fd1a2fd1c9837049cb6bd5695973f73b316957079eb
spent
true